From 503071f0f4bb943e6339e213aae69b4b8d3ddd59 Mon Sep 17 00:00:00 2001 From: dec05eba Date: Mon, 14 Sep 2020 19:34:48 +0200 Subject: Use opengl v3.3 --- src/QuickMedia.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src') diff --git a/src/QuickMedia.cpp b/src/QuickMedia.cpp index f24be55..7027ac9 100644 --- a/src/QuickMedia.cpp +++ b/src/QuickMedia.cpp @@ -142,7 +142,7 @@ static bool enable_vsync(Display *disp, Window window) { namespace QuickMedia { Program::Program() : disp(nullptr), - window(sf::VideoMode(1280, 720), "QuickMedia"), + window(sf::VideoMode(1280, 720), "QuickMedia", sf::Style::Default, sf::ContextSettings(0, 0, 0, 3, 3)), window_size(1280, 720), body(nullptr), current_plugin(nullptr), @@ -1292,7 +1292,7 @@ namespace QuickMedia { if(!current_plugin->is_image_board()) { related_media_window_size.x = window_size.x * RELATED_MEDIA_WINDOW_WIDTH; related_media_window_size.y = window_size.y; - related_media_window = std::make_unique(sf::VideoMode(related_media_window_size.x, related_media_window_size.y), "", 0); + related_media_window = std::make_unique(sf::VideoMode(related_media_window_size.x, related_media_window_size.y), "", 0, sf::ContextSettings(0, 0, 0, 3, 3)); related_media_window->setFramerateLimit(0); if(!enable_vsync(disp, related_media_window->getSystemHandle())) { fprintf(stderr, "Failed to enable vsync, fallback to frame limiting\n"); -- cgit v1.2.3